  • Ask HN: How did you earn your first $100 and first $1k online?
    My GIF making site https://gifmemes.io made over 1k, totally maybe >5k at this point from watermark removals and donations. What was crucial for growth was a few reddit frontpage memes with the link in the comments. Then just slow and steady google traffic increase and now it's stable for the past few months. - Source: Hacker News / 12 months ago

  • OpenTofu 1.7.0 is out with State Encryption, Dynamic Provider-defined Functions
    None of these are a replacement of Terraform Cloud (recently rebranded to HCP Terraform). For example, when you create a PR, it could affect multiple workspaces. The new experimental version of TFC/TFE (I refuse to call it HCP!) implements Stacks, which is something like a workflow, and links one workspace output to other workspace inputs. None of the open-source solutions, including the paid Digger [0], support... - Source: Hacker News / 2 months ago
